Editor's takeDocuSign's rank comes from a status no competitor can copy, the exclusive NAR REALTOR Benefits partnership, paired with deep zipForm integration that pulls forms straight into Transaction Rooms. The signing experience itself is well rated. The Rooms backend and the lack of live support are the documented friction points agents should plan around.
Is DocuSign the official REALTORS e-signature provider?
Yes. DocuSign is the National Association of REALTORS' official and exclusive electronic signature provider under the REALTOR Benefits Program, offering a member-exclusive plan at $20 per user per month.
Is DocuSign customer support good?
Reviewers frequently cite frustration with reaching live representatives, relying instead on chatbots or ticketing systems, even though the core signing product itself is well rated.
